ヘデラ(HBAR)初心者が知るべき裏技3選!
分散型台帳技術(DLT)の世界において、ヘデラ・ハッシュグラフ(Hedera Hashgraph)は、その革新的なコンセンサスアルゴリズムと高いスケーラビリティで注目を集めています。本稿では、ヘデラ(HBAR)を初めて利用する方が知っておくべき、より効果的に活用するための3つの裏技を紹介します。これらのテクニックは、単なる取引にとどまらず、ヘデラの潜在能力を最大限に引き出すためのものです。
1.スマートコントラクトの効率的な開発とデプロイメント
ヘデラは、スマートコントラクトの実行環境として、Hedera Smart Contract Service (HSCS) を提供しています。HSCSは、Ethereum Virtual Machine (EVM) と互換性があり、Solidityで記述されたスマートコントラクトを比較的容易にデプロイできます。しかし、ヘデラの特性を活かすためには、いくつかの注意点があります。
裏技1:コンセンサス・タイムスタンプの活用 ヘデラは、他のブロックチェーンとは異なり、コンセンサス・タイムスタンプと呼ばれる、ネットワーク全体で合意された正確な時間情報をスマートコントラクト内で利用できます。このタイムスタンプは、スマートコントラクトのロジックに組み込むことで、時間依存型の処理を安全かつ確実に実行できます。例えば、特定の時間経過後に自動的に実行される契約や、時間に基づいて報酬を分配するシステムなどを構築できます。この機能は、従来のブロックチェーンでは実現が困難であった高度なスマートコントラクトの構築を可能にします。
裏技2:ガス代の最適化 ヘデラでは、ガス代(取引手数料)が比較的低く抑えられています。しかし、スマートコントラクトの複雑さや実行回数によっては、ガス代が無視できないレベルになる場合があります。ガス代を最適化するためには、以下の点に注意する必要があります。
- 不要な計算処理を避ける
- データの保存量を最小限に抑える
- ループ処理を効率的に行う
また、ヘデラは、スマートコントラクトの実行に必要な計算リソースを事前に見積もるツールを提供しています。このツールを活用することで、ガス代を事前に予測し、最適化することができます。
裏技3:Hedera Developer Toolsの活用 ヘデラは、スマートコントラクトの開発を支援するための様々なツールを提供しています。Hedera Developer Toolsは、スマートコントラクトのデプロイ、テスト、デバッグなどを容易にするための統合開発環境です。このツールを活用することで、開発効率を大幅に向上させることができます。また、Hedera SDKを利用することで、様々なプログラミング言語からヘデラネットワークにアクセスできます。
2.HBARのステーキングによる収益化
ヘデラネットワークのセキュリティを維持するために、HBARのステーキングが重要な役割を果たしています。HBARをステーキングすることで、ネットワークの運営に貢献し、その報酬としてHBARを受け取ることができます。ステーキングは、HBARを長期的に保有する方にとって、魅力的な収益化手段となります。
裏技1:ネットワークノードの選定 ヘデラネットワークには、様々なネットワークノードが存在します。ネットワークノードによって、ステーキング報酬の利率やセキュリティレベルが異なる場合があります。信頼性の高いネットワークノードを選定することで、より高いステーキング報酬を得ることができます。ネットワークノードの選定には、過去のパフォーマンス、セキュリティ対策、運営体制などを考慮する必要があります。
裏技2:ステーキング期間の最適化 ヘデラでは、ステーキング期間を自由に設定できます。ステーキング期間が長ければ長いほど、ステーキング報酬の利率が高くなる傾向があります。しかし、ステーキング期間が長すぎると、HBARを自由に利用できなくなるというデメリットがあります。ステーキング期間は、自身の資金計画やHBARの利用目的に合わせて最適化する必要があります。
裏技3:Hedera Staking Serviceの利用 ヘデラは、ステーキングを容易にするためのHedera Staking Serviceを提供しています。このサービスを利用することで、複雑な設定や管理作業を省略し、簡単にステーキングを開始できます。Hedera Staking Serviceは、初心者の方にとって、HBARのステーキングを始めるための最適な方法と言えるでしょう。
3.ヘデラの分散型ファイルストレージサービス(HFS)の活用
ヘデラは、分散型ファイルストレージサービス(HFS)を提供しています。HFSは、ファイルを安全かつ効率的に保存するためのサービスであり、従来のクラウドストレージサービスと比較して、いくつかの利点があります。HFSは、データの改ざん防止、高い可用性、低コストなどを実現します。
裏技1:データの暗号化 HFSに保存するデータは、暗号化することで、より高いセキュリティを確保できます。データの暗号化には、AESなどの強力な暗号化アルゴリズムを使用する必要があります。暗号化されたデータは、許可されたユーザーのみが復号化できます。
裏技2:データの冗長化 HFSは、データを複数の場所に分散して保存することで、高い可用性を実現しています。しかし、データの冗長化をさらに強化することで、より高い信頼性を確保できます。データの冗長化には、Erasure Codingなどの技術を使用できます。Erasure Codingは、データを分割し、冗長情報を付加することで、一部のデータが失われてもデータを復元できる技術です。
裏技3:HFS APIの活用 HFSは、APIを提供しており、プログラムからHFSにアクセスできます。HFS APIを活用することで、アプリケーションにHFSの機能を組み込むことができます。例えば、アプリケーションからファイルをHFSにアップロードしたり、HFSからファイルをダウンロードしたりすることができます。HFS APIは、開発者にとって、HFSをより効果的に活用するための強力なツールとなります。
注意点: ヘデラは、比較的新しい技術であり、まだ発展途上にあります。そのため、利用する際には、最新の情報を常に確認し、リスクを十分に理解する必要があります。
まとめ
本稿では、ヘデラ(HBAR)を初めて利用する方が知っておくべき、3つの裏技を紹介しました。スマートコントラクトの効率的な開発とデプロイメント、HBARのステーキングによる収益化、ヘデラの分散型ファイルストレージサービス(HFS)の活用は、ヘデラの潜在能力を最大限に引き出すための重要なテクニックです。これらのテクニックを習得することで、ヘデラをより効果的に活用し、分散型台帳技術の未来を切り開くことができるでしょう。ヘデラは、その革新的な技術と高いスケーラビリティにより、今後ますます注目を集めることが予想されます。ぜひ、ヘデラを活用して、新たな価値を創造してください。